BOURBON CHICKEN



Bourbon Chicken image

A favorite named after Bourbon Street in New Orleans, Louisiana and for the bourbon whiskey ingredient; although this dish, sold as Cajun-style cuisine in malls all over America, is reported to be nothing of the kind (not genuine Creole or Cajun fare)! Note: If you double the recipe, make sure that the chicken is still in a single layer. Laissez les bons temps rouler!

Provided by Lucy Loo

Categories     Meat and Poultry Recipes     Chicken     Chicken Breast Recipes     Healthy

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 7

4 skinless, boneless chicken breast halves
1 teaspoon ground ginger
4 ounces soy sauce
2 tablespoons dried minced onion
½ cup packed brown sugar
⅜ cup bourbon
½ teaspoon garlic powder

Steps:

  • Place chicken breasts in a 9x13 inch baking dish. In a small bowl combine the ginger, soy sauce, onion flakes, sugar, bourbon and garlic powder. Mix together and pour mixture over chicken. Cover dish and place in refrigerator. Marinate overnight.
  • Preheat oven to 325 degrees F (165 degrees C).
  • Remove dish from refrigerator and remove cover. Bake in the preheated oven, basting frequently, for 1 1/2 hours or until chicken is well browned and juices run clear.

BEST BOURBON CHICKEN



Best Bourbon Chicken image

Bourbon Chicken is traditionally a Southern dish, and after moving to Pennsylvania from Oklahoma, I really missed this. I searched for a recipe I liked, but I couldn't find one, so this is my own delicious version, spiced up with ginger, fruit juice, red pepper, and a little Southern Comfort! Serve over rice.

Provided by Rikster67

Categories     Meat and Poultry Recipes     Chicken     Chicken Breast Recipes

Time 1h

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 15

4 tablespoons olive oil
3 pounds skinless, boneless chicken breast halves - cut into 1 inch pieces
1 cup water
1 cup packed light brown sugar
¾ cup apple-grape-cherry juice
⅔ cup soy sauce
¼ cup ketchup
¼ cup peach-flavored bourbon liqueur (such as Southern Comfort ®)
2 tablespoons apple cider vinegar
2 cloves garlic, minced
1 tablespoon dried minced onion
¾ te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es, or to taste
½ teaspoon ground ginger
¼ cup apple-grape-cherry juice
2 tablespoons cornstarch

Steps:

  • Heat the oil in a large heavy pan or Dutch oven, and brown the chicken pieces until lightly golden on all sides, about 10 minutes. Transfer the chicken to a bowl.
  • In the same dutch oven, whisk the water, brown sugar, 3/4 cup of fruit juice cocktail, soy sauce, ketchup, bourbon liqueur, apple cider vinegar, garlic, dried onion, red pepper flakes, and ground ginger into the Dutch oven. Bring the sauce to a boil while scraping the browned bits of food off of the bottom of the pan with a wooden spoon.
  • Stir the chicken back into the sauce, and bring to a full boil over medium-high heat. Reduce the heat to medium-low, and simmer until the sauce is reduced and thickened and the chicken pieces are no longer pink in the middle, about 20 minutes.
  • Remove the chicken pieces to a bowl with a slotted spoon. Stir together 1/4 cup of fruit juice cocktail with the cornstarch until smooth, and whisk the cornstarch mixture into the sauce, stirring constantly to avoid lumps. Bring the sauce back to a simmer, let thicken for about 1 minute, and return the chicken pieces to the sauce. Stir to combine, and serve.

BOURBON CHICKEN & JASMINE RICE



Bourbon Chicken & Jasmine Rice image

Bourbon chicken is a dish named after Bourbon Street in New Orleans, Louisiana and for the bourbon whiskey ingredient. The dish is commonly found at Cajun-themed Chinese restaurants.

Provided by A Taste of Brooklyn

Categories     Chicken

Time 42m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 13

sesame oil
2 lbs chicken tenderloins, bite-size pieces
3 large garlic cloves, chopped
1 tablespoon fresh ginger, chopped
1/4 teaspoon red pepper flakes (optional)
1/2 cup apple juice
1/2 cup dark brown sugar
2 tablespoons ketchup
1 tablespoon rice vinegar
1/4 cup bourbon whiskey
1/3 cup soy sauce
2 cups jasmine rice, uncooked
4 scallions, - 1 inch bias (green part only)

Steps:

  • In a wok, over high heat, add 2 tablespoons oil and when hot, working in batches, add the chicken and cook until lightly browned, about 3 to 5 minute Remove and set aside.
  • Reduce the heat to medium, add the garlic, ginger and red pepper flakes and cook until fragrant, about 30 sec. Add in the apple juice, sugar, ketchup, vinegar, whiskey and soy sauce and cook stirring until the sugar dissolves, about 1 minute Return the chicken and bring to a boil. Lower heat to low and simmer for 20 minute.
  • In the meantime, cook the rice according to package directions. Serve the chicken over the rice and garnish with the scallions.

Tips:

  • Choose high-quality ingredients: Use fresh and flavorful ingredients to make your Bourbon Chicken stand out. Look for juicy chicken thighs, a flavorful bourbon, and a high-quality teriyaki sauce.
  • Don't overcrowd the pan: When cooking the chicken, make sure to not overcrowd the pan. This will help the chicken cook evenly and prevent it from steaming.
  • Use a good quality bourbon: The bourbon is a key ingredient in this dish, so make sure to use a good quality one. Look for a bourbon that is smooth and has a good flavor.
  • Don't overcook the chicken: The chicken should be cooked until it is cooked through but still juicy. Overcooking the chicken will make it dry and tough.
  • Serve with a side of rice: Bourbon Chicken is traditionally served with a side of rice. This helps to soak up the delicious sauce and makes a complete meal.
